線性規划問題的基本內容 線性規划解決的是自變量在一定的線性約束條件下,使得線性目標函數求得最大值或者最小值的問題。 \[\min z=\sum_{j=1}^{n} f_{j} x_{j} \] \[\text { s.t. }\left\{\begin{array ...
非線性規划問題的基本內容 非線性規划解決的是自變量在一定的非線性約束或線性約束組合條件下,使得非線性目標函數求得最大值或者最小值的問題。 當目標函數為最小值時,上述問題可以寫成如下形式: min z F x text s.t. left begin array l mathbf A mathbf X leqslant mathbf B mathbf A mathrm eq mathbf X ma ...
2019-09-09 11:15 0 1347 推薦指數:
線性規划問題的基本內容 線性規划解決的是自變量在一定的線性約束條件下,使得線性目標函數求得最大值或者最小值的問題。 \[\min z=\sum_{j=1}^{n} f_{j} x_{j} \] \[\text { s.t. }\left\{\begin{array ...
非線性規划 在matlab非線性規划數學模型可以寫成一下形式: \[minf(x)\\ s.t.\begin{cases} Ax \le B \\ Aeq·x = Beq\\ C(x) \le 0\\ Ceq(x) = 0 \end{cases} \] f(x)為目標函數,A,B ...
MATLAB求解非線性規划可以使用 fmincon 函數,其數學模型可以寫成如下形式: x = fmincon(fun,x0,A,b,Aeq,beq,lb,ub,nonlcon,options) 其中,fun是目標函數,x0是初始值,A,b 規定線性不等式約束條件,Aeq ...
整數線性規划問題的基本內容 整數線性規划解決的是自變量在一定的線性約束條件下,使得線性目標函數求得最大值或者最小值的問題。其中自變量只能取整數。特別地,當自變量只能取0或者1時,稱之為 0-1 整數規划問題。 當目標函數為最小值時,上述問題可以寫成如下形式: \[\min ...
title: 數學規划模型——非線性規划問題 date: 2020-02-26 20:10:37 categories: 數學建模 tags: [MATLAB, 數學規划模型] Matlab 中⾮線性規划的標准型 \[min \ f(x) \\ \ \\ s.t. ...
1.線性規划 求線性規划問題的最優解有兩種方法,一種方法是使用linprog命令,另一種是使用optimtool工具箱,下面分別介紹這兩種方法. ①linprog命令 一般情況下,Linprog命令的參數形式為[x,fval] = linprog(f,A,b,Aeq,beq,lb,ub,x0 ...
當目標函數含有非線性函數或者含有非線性約束的時候該規划問題變為非線性規划問題,非線性規划問題的最優解不一定在定義域的邊界,可能在定義域內部,這點與線性規划不同; 例如: 編寫目標函數,定義放在一個m文件中;編寫非線性約束條件函數矩陣,放在另一個m文件中 ...
1.非線性規划的形式: 其中x是一個列向量,st中前兩項為線性約束條件,后兩項為非線性約束條件。 在MATLAB中fmincon是用於求解非線性多遠函數的最小值的函數,這里介紹fmincon的其中一種語法格式: [x,fval,exitflag,output]=fmincon[目標函數f ...